This review is from: Monster-in-Law [DVD] (DVD)
i loved this film, it was sweet and a little funny but it didn't go overboard with useless jokes that no-one laughs at, the acting was superb and the film was overall a hit.
I didn't expect to be impressed by it when i bought it under the reccomendation of a friend but i was pleasently suprised, it was actually good with J Lo in it. The scenario is realistic, an overprotected mother doesn't want her son to marry anyone let alone a woman who skips between about 5 jobs and she will go to all lengths to stop the marriage, even fake an anxiety attack and pay a man to pretend to be a doctor. I loved it sooooo much, great for a girly night in.

This review is from: Monster-in-Law [DVD] (DVD)
Actually watched this the day it arrived, and really pleased I did. Having seen the trailer for it on another movie, I knew it had to added to my rental list. Although single myself, I've worked with enough people to know quite a bit about Mother In Laws to put me off them.
Cannot recall seeing Jane Fonda in a movie since Barbarella, but her comedy in this is first class especially the nut allergy and her "don't leave/stay with me" supposedly girly friendship with her new daughter-in-law played by Jennifer Lopez. This was only the second film I've seen Lopez in (the other being Angel Eyes) and her move to comedy was a good one, so wouldn't hesitate to try others. Also liked the personal assistant character although my only complaint would be some of her lines were not that clear leaving the viewer to work out what she said. The appearance by Elaine Stritch was a total surprise when she went up in the cast, couldn't think what character she would play in this type of movie, but you'll have to rent it to find the connection. Overall a really enjoyable film, would highly recommend.
